    I'm waiting as well. I ran the white rigid sae for years. I liked them but the color was too blue. Having ran the selective yellow for 7 months I wouldn't go back. They do have a great cutoff and don't illuminate signs like those bd pics at all. The pods just don't look as good as a circular light.
